This co-op was designed with our local communities in mind. The intent is to Build Community by Caring for each other through Sharing our talents and needs. It is really quite simple and practical; very much like they did in the book of Acts. As a result of the community they created, all their needs were met. Can you imagine that; everyone's needs being met? As you have probably already noticed, at the top of this page I have listed a few talents and needs we share on a daily basis. We all have talents and we all have needs, so why not build community through reaching out to each other and sharing what we have to offer. You see, it works like this: Sally is a single mom and her income is very limited. She has a Chevy Malibu that is about 10 years old and needs some repairs done on it. However, she does not have the extra money to pay a repair shop. James is a skilled mechanic and he loves what he does, but he is not that talented in every area of his life. His 13 year old son is really struggling in school with his language lessons and James is having a difficult time helping him with his studies. Sally and James find each other on the co-op and trade services. Their problem solved. You can also trade items. Perhaps you've been playing the guitar and have decided that the experience is not what you expected. You want to try a different instrument and you find someone in the co-op with a flute. The two of you decide to do some trading and bingo, another need is met.
